## Deployment

Heads up, plugin authors: Exportron handles retries for failed exports on its own, so don't bolt your own retry loop on top — you'll just double-send. When you deploy your plugin to a Quillhaven worker, the retry behavior (backoff, max attempts, dead-letter routing) comes entirely from the service config. Your deployed plugin should ship with these configuration values:

settings of tagef-bawif:
DRUIX_HOST=druix.zemvarlabs.internal
DRUIX_PORT=8000

Snapshot tests for the Glintbar UI components run against the Pixelvault comparison service. Before cutting a release, verify the snapshot suite passes on the release branch; diffs must be approved in Pixelvault, not suppressed locally. The runner authenticates once per session and caches nothing between builds, so stale tokens fail fast. Regenerate baselines only after design sign-off from the Quartzline team. The suite reads its credential from the environment at startup. Use the key below for the Pixelvault staging endpoint.

gateway credential: kto3_qfe

**Ticket: Config drift — catalog cache invalidation**

The Pellwright catalog service in staging no longer matches production. TTL-based invalidation was disabled manually in staging sometime last sprint; purge-on-write events stopped firing. Stale prices served for up to six hours. Drift was not caught by the nightly diff job. Current production values for review are as follows.

config for yajep-tafof:
[rusath]
team = julmir
access_code = ac_fe37fd
host = rusath.novactech.test
port = 8000
owner = pelmir.weneth
peer = oliwyn.olvarqdyn.internal